....Titled "Performance Tuner" - http://www.performancetuner.co.uk

The first issue includes:

- Hot hatch group head-to-head .

- Track fight between modded BMW Z3M and standard Z4M Coupes.

- Don Palmer FWD vs RWD vs 4WD feature.

- APS R300 R32 feature [Richard, I'll bring you my mag copy when we meet next week].

- How to: Go on a Track Day.

Plus news 'n reviews etc. Also some good reader offers such as 20% off Eibach products.

The mag attracted me enough to buy it rather than just read it in WHSmith's high street 'library' as I usually do. Cost £3.95 - Good value I reckon. I probably won't subscribe but I'll deffo check it out each month.
